Boost WordPress Performance with Hummingbird

Maintaining a fast website is crucial for any website owner, as studies show that visitors may abandon a site if it takes longer than three seconds to load. Slow page loading times can negatively impact visitor satisfaction and Search Engine Optimization (SEO). Search engines take site speed into account when deciding how to rank web pages, and the higher your site shows up in search results, the greater number of people who will see it and click through.

There are several factors that can affect your WordPress site’s speed, including your web host, memory, your site’s theme, and plugins. Reviewing these factors can help ensure that your WordPress site performance is in top shape. However, even if all of these factors are accounted for, your site may still not perform as smoothly as you’d like. Fortunately, there are many ways you can improve speeds on any WordPress website.

One solution is to use a suite of performance optimization tools, such as the Hummingbird plugin. This free speed optimization plugin enables you to improve your site’s speeds in a number of easy ways, without the need for additional tools or much technical knowledge. Here are four ways the Hummingbird plugin can help improve your WordPress site performance:

1. Caching: WordPress caching is a way to save some of your site’s data in a more convenient location so that it can be accessed and retrieved more quickly. The Hummingbird plugin provides various different types of caching, including page caching and browser caching.

2. GZIP Compression: GZIP compression is a way to make your site’s files smaller and faster to load without losing any necessary data in the process. The Hummingbird plugin enables you to enable three different types of GZIP compression.

3. Minification: Minification is another way to help your site perform faster by removing unnecessary data from your code. The Hummingbird plugin lets you optimize whichever files you like and even move certain ‘behind-the-scenes’ code files to your site’s footer.

4. Performance Scans: Running periodic performance scans can help you identify files that may be slowing down your site. The Hummingbird plugin provides performance scans that can help you identify areas for improvement.

Using an ‘all-in-one’ free speed optimization plugin like Hummingbird can help you implement the most vital steps quickly and easily. By optimizing your site’s performance through caching, GZIP compression, minification, and performance scans, you can ensure that your WordPress site is running as smoothly and quickly as possible.
